Preventing illiteracy: AREVA Corporate Foundation reinforces its commitment

9/19/2014
In brief

All of the partners participating in the “Taking action together against illiteracy” movement in 2013 have elected to strengthen their cooperation by organizing the first national action days against illiteracy from September 8 to 12, 2014. The objective is to build collective awareness, highlight what works, and roll out new solutions. 

The week of actions was an opportunity to reiterate the AREVA Corporate Foundation’s strong commitment to preventing illiteracy: it has been a partner of the National Agency for Illiteracy Prevention (ANLCI, Agence nationale de lutte contre l’illettrisme) since 2012 and renewed its support in 2014 for an additional three years.

The Foundation supports the deployment of Family Education Actions that help parents refresh their knowledge of the basics at a time when their children are beginning to learn them in school. Seven units located near AREVA sites are supported in metropolitan France, such as the “Pied à l’étrier” association in Bollène, the national adult education program (“Greta”) in Chalon-sur-Saône, and the “Mots et Merveilles” association in the Nord-Pas-de-Calais region.
